Practical STEM Education Captivating Pupils Via Immersive Instruction

The shift towards practical STEM instruction is seeing significant popularity in contemporary classrooms. Rather than just absorbing facts from guides or talks, learners thrive when they truly engage in experiential projects. This approach – often termed "Hands-On STEM" – encourages a deeper understanding of challenging principles. It allows for exploration and fosters crucial competencies like analytical skills, teamwork , and innovation . Think about the impact of creating a robot versus reading its inner workings ! A process transforms students from passive recipients of data into active participants in their individual STEM exploration.

  • Build a basic structure using limited supplies.
  • Execute an trial to study the consequences of force .
  • Develop a introductory virtual environment .

STEM Education Beyond the Setting: Practical Uses

Genuinely understanding STEM isn't solely achieved inside the typical classroom . This requires connecting academic theories to tangible scenarios. Consider opportunities like participating in robotics competitions which demand problem-solving abilities , designing sustainable solutions click here for local community concerns, or building simple devices to illustrate fundamental physics concepts .

  • Volunteering at a science facility provides valuable exposure to interactive demonstrations.
  • Coding projects can transform abstract sequences into functional programs .
  • Participating in environmental monitoring activities fosters awareness and practical skills in ecological analysis.
These types of engagements cultivate critical thinking, creativity, and collaboration – essential qualities for future breakthroughs and triumph in a rapidly evolving environment.
